
Hardback
Published 14 Jul 2025
Save $1.46
- RRP $24.36
- $22.90
8 results
$1.46off
Hardback
Published 14 Jul 2025
Save $1.46
Hardback
Published 10 Jun 2019
Not available for sale
Paperback
Published 16 Feb 2001
Hardback
Published 15 Jun 2010
$4.38off
Hardback
|
English,French
Published 01 Mar 2010
Save $4.38
Paperback
Published 30 Jun 1995
Paperback
Published 01 Dec 2000
Book
Published 02 Nov 1992